LME aluminium benchmark price gains US$21/t; SHFE price moves down by US$2/t

On Tuesday, LME aluminium opened at US$2,532 per tonne, with a high of US$2,554 per tonne and a low of US$2,502.5 per tonne, closing at US$2,546.5 per tonne, up US$13 per tonne or 0.51 per cent.

On Tuesday, August 27, both LME aluminium cash bid price and LME aluminium official settlement price gained US$19.5 per tonne or 0.78 per cent and US$21 per tonne or 0.84 per cent to clock at US$2,518 per tonne and US$2,520 per tonne.

3-month bid price and 3-month offer price hiked by US$26.5 per tonne or 1.05 per cent and US$28 per tonne or 1.11 per cent to settle at US$2,535 per tonne and US$2,537 per tonne.

December 25 bid price and December 25 offer price ascended by US$20 per tonne or 0.75 per cent to dock at US$2,655 per tonne and US$2,660 per tonne. LME aluminium opening stock came in at 867225 tonnes.

Live warrants and Cancelled warrants stood at 346625 tonnes and 520600 tonnes. LME aluminium 3-month Asian Reference Price expanded by US$25.06 per tonne or 1 per cent to reach US$2,515.52 per tonne.
